Technical Field
[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of interior decoration tools, in particular to a wood tenoning machine for interior decoration. Background Art
[0002] The mortise and tenon structure is a commonly used structure in ancient wooden buildings. This structure is also often used in the production of furniture. Therefore, in the process of interior decoration, it is necessary to mortise and tenon the wood. At present, a mortise and tenon machine is usually used to mortise the wood. In the prior art, some schemes about mortise and tenon machines are disclosed, such as the schemes disclosed in authorized patent documents such as application numbers CN202222934595.0 and CN202320120148.3. In the above-mentioned schemes, the structure for clamping and fixing the wood and the structure for mortising the wood are integrated, resulting in a large size of the scheme, difficulty in moving, and being unsuitable for use in interior decoration; when the mortise and tenon machine cuts different tenons on the wood or the mortise knife is damaged, the mortise knife needs to be replaced, and the mortise knife in the above-mentioned scheme is fixed in position, and it is more troublesome to disassemble and assemble the mortise knife, which affects the efficiency of replacing the mortise knife; based on this, the present application proposes a wood mortise and tenon machine for interior decoration. [0022] The utility model provides a wood tenoning machine for interior decoration, comprising a tenoning structure and a wood fixing structure, the tenoning structure comprising a tenoning motor 1 and a tenoning knife 3, an isolation sleeve 2 is fixedly connected to the outer surface of the tenoning motor 1, a handle is fixed to one side of the isolation sleeve 2, the setting of the isolation sleeve 2 facilitates construction workers to move the tenoning structure, and the isolation sleeve 2 can protect the tenoning motor 1, and ventilation holes are evenly provided on the isolation sleeve 2 to facilitate heat dissipation of the tenoning motor 1.
[0023] The mortising motor 1 and the mortising cutter 3 are connected through a connecting structure, which includes a connecting block 4 fixedly connected to the end of the output shaft of the mortising motor 1 and a connecting block 5 fixedly connected to the mortising cutter 3. A groove 6 is provided in the middle of one side of the connecting block 4, and a shaping groove 13 is provided at the top of the middle of one side of the connecting block 2 5. The shaping groove 13 is a convex structure, and the top of the shaping groove 13 is adapted to the groove 6.
[0024] The connecting block 1 4 is snap-fitted to the connecting block 2 5 , and a snap-fit block 14 is fixedly connected to the top of the connecting block 2 5 , and a snap-fitting slot 15 adapted to the snap-fitting block 14 is provided at the bottom of the connecting block 1 4 . Through the arrangement of the snap-fitting slot 15 and the snap-fitting block 14 , the connecting block 1 4 and the connecting block 2 5 can be snap-fitted and play a positioning role, so that when the connecting block 2 5 is connected to the connecting block 1 4 , the groove 6 can contact the top of the shaping groove 13 , which facilitates further fixation of the connecting block 1 4 and the connecting block 2 5 .
[0025] The top of the inner cavity of the groove 6 is fixedly connected with a spring 7 and a telescopic rod 8, and the other ends of the spring 7 and the telescopic rod 8 are fixedly connected with a moving block 16. The moving block 16 is movably connected to the inner cavity of the groove 6, and the thickness of the moving block 16 is not greater than the depth of the inner cavity of the groove 6. Preferably, the thickness of the moving block 16 is half of the depth of the inner cavity of the groove 6. Through the setting of the spring 7, under the action of external force, the position of the moving block 16 in the groove 6 can be changed. During the movement of the moving block 16, the telescopic rod 8 can limit the moving block 16, so that the moving block 16 moves in the telescopic direction of the spring 7 to avoid displacement of the moving block 16.
[0026] Both ends of the outer side of the moving block 16 are provided with a telescopic groove 17, and the inner cavity of the telescopic groove 17 is movably connected to the limit block 11. The limit block 11 is connected to the telescopic groove 17 by a spring 2 12. The outer side of the limit block 11 is fixedly connected with a shaped block 10. The bottom end of the shaped groove 13 is adapted to the shaped block 10. The other end of the shaped block 10 extends to the outside of the groove 6. Through the setting of the spring 2 12, under the action of the rebound force of the spring 2 12, the shaped block 10 can fit closely with the inner wall of the groove 6, fixing the moving The position of block 16 in groove 6 prevents the movable block 16 from moving randomly in groove 6, which is convenient for storing the mortising motor 1. When the shaping block 10 is aligned with the bottom end of the shaping groove 13, the shaping block 10 can fit tightly with the inner wall of the shaping groove 13 under the action of the rebound force of spring 2 12. At this time, the top of the shaping groove 13 limits the shaping block 10 and fixes the position of the movable block 16, so that the connecting block 1 4 and the connecting block 2 5 are further fixed, thereby improving the reliability of the mortising structure during use.
[0027] An electromagnet 9 is fixed to the center of the shaping block 10. When energized, the electromagnets 9 on the two shaping blocks 10 are magnetically attracted to each other. The attraction between the two electromagnets 9 offsets the thrust of spring 2 12 on the shaping blocks 10, allowing the outer sides of the two shaping blocks 10 to align with the ends of the movable block 16. This releases further fixation between connecting block 1 4 and connecting block 2 5 or allows the shaping blocks 10 to separate from the inner wall of the groove 6, facilitating the separation or fixing of connecting block 1 4 and connecting block 2 5. The model of electromagnet 9 may be LS-P20 / 23S.
[0028] From the above description of the mortise and tenon structure, it can be seen that by turning the electromagnet 9 on and off and by driving the moving block 16 through the shaping block 10, the connecting block 1 4 and the connecting block 2 5 can be quickly fixed or separated, thereby improving the replacement efficiency of the mortise cutter 3.
[0029] The wood-fixing structure includes a workbench 18, one side of which is connected to a wood-positioning block 20 via a first movable structure, and one side of which is connected to a wood-pressing plate 19 via a second movable structure. The bottom of the wood-positioning block 20 contacts the top of the workbench 18. The L-shaped wood-positioning block 20 limits the position of the wood, ensuring that the position of the same batch of wood on the workbench 18 remains consistent, making it easier for the wood-pressing plate 19 to press and secure the wood.
[0030] Movable structure 1 includes a ball screw 1 27 movably connected to workbench 18. The outer ring of ball screw 1 27 is threadedly connected to ball nut 1, and the top of ball nut 1 is movably connected to ball screw 2 24. Ball screw 1 27 and ball screw 2 24 are perpendicular to each other. The outer ring of ball screw 24 is threadedly connected to ball nut 2, and the outer ring of ball nut 2 is fixedly connected to a movable sleeve 21. The inner cavity of movable sleeve 21 is movably connected to ball screw 2 24. The other end of movable sleeve 21 is connected to a wood positioning block 20, and the bottom of wood positioning block 20 contacts the top of workbench 18. Through the arrangement of ball screw 1 27 and ball screw 2 24, wood positioning block 20 can move longitudinally and transversely within a horizontal plane under the action of movable structure 1, so that the position of wood on workbench 18 can be changed as needed, improving the practicality of the wood fixing structure.
[0031] The movable structure 2 includes a ball screw 3 23 movably connected to the workbench 18, the outer ring of the ball screw 3 23 is threadedly connected to the ball nut 3 28, the top of the ball nut 3 28 is movably connected to the ball screw 4 22, the outer ring of the ball screw 4 22 is threadedly connected to the ball nut 4, the outer ring of the ball nut 4 is fixedly connected to the support rod 26, the outer ring of the support rod 26 is movably sleeved with a connecting sleeve 25, the wood pressing plate 19 is fixedly connected to the connecting sleeve 25, and the connecting sleeve 25 is connected to the support rod 26 by a bolt, and the bolt is threadedly connected to a side wall of the connecting sleeve 25. When the bolt is tightly fitted to the support rod 26, the connecting sleeve 25 and the support rod 26 can be fixed. By setting up the movable structure 2, under the action of the ball screw 3 23, the distance between the wood pressing plate 19 and the workbench 18 can be changed, and the contact position between the wood pressing plate 19 and the wood can be changed. Under the action of the ball screw 4 22, the height of the wood pressing plate 19 can be changed, and the wood fixing structure can fix wood of various thicknesses; under the action of the connecting sleeve 25, the contact position between the wood pressing plate 19 and the wood can be changed, so as to avoid the wood pressing plate 19 blocking the mortise and tenon part of the wood, thereby facilitating the mortise and tenoning of the wood.
[0032] From the description of the wood fixing structure, it can be seen that the wood positioning block 20 can keep the position of the same batch of wood on the workbench 18 consistent, so that the contact part between the wood pressing plate 19 and the wood is consistent, ensuring the firmness of the wood pressing plate 19 in fixing the wood, and avoiding the wood pressing plate 19 from restricting the wood mortising, thereby facilitating the processing of wood.

[0035] In summary: when the wood tenoning machine for interior decoration is used, the construction workers move the wood fixing structure and the tenoning structure to the room to be decorated respectively, and fix the wood fixing structure at a suitable position indoors. When fixing a type of wood for the first time, the construction worker places the wood to be mortised at a suitable position on the workbench 18, tightens the bolts, and releases the fixation of the connecting sleeve 25. The construction worker drives the wood pressing plate 19 to move through the connecting sleeve 25 until the wood pressing plate 19 moves to the top of the wood. The construction worker screws the ball screw four 22. The rotation of the ball screw four 22 causes the wood pressing plate 19 to move in the vertical direction until the wood pressing plate 19 is tightly fitted with the wood, thereby fixing the wood. The position of the wood positioning block 20 is changed by moving structure one until the wood positioning block 20 is tightly fitted with the wood. The construction worker drives the mortise knife 3 to rotate through the mortise motor 1, and the mortise knife 3 can perform the mortise operation on the wood. After the mortise operation is completed, the limit of the wood pressing plate 19 on the wood is released, and the mortised wood can be removed. After the construction worker replaces the same type of wood, he can quickly fix the wood by screwing the ball screw four 22.
[0036] When the mortise cutter 3 needs to be replaced, the electromagnet 9 continues to be energized. When the electromagnet 9 is energized, the two electromagnets 9 are in a state of magnetic attraction. Under the action of this suction force, the two shaping blocks 10 approach each other until the shaping block 10 moves to the bottom of the inner cavity of the groove 6, releasing the restriction of the shaping groove 13 on the moving block 16. Under the action of the rebound force of the spring 1 7, the moving block 16 can move away from the shaping groove 13. The construction personnel pull the connecting block 2 5 to separate the connecting block 2 5 from the connecting block 1 4, thereby removing the mortise cutter 3. After the connecting block 2 5 of the new mortise and tenon cutter 3 is connected with the connecting block 1 4, the user pulls the shaping block 10 to move until the moving block 16 is tightly fitted with the bottom of the inner cavity of the shaping groove 13, and the power is cut off to the electromagnet 9. Under the action of the rebound force of the spring 2 12, the shaping block 10 is tightly fitted with the inner wall of the bottom end of the shaping groove 13, and the top of the shaping groove 13 limits the shaping block 10. The connecting block 1 4 and the connecting block 2 5 are further fixed, and the replacement operation of the mortise and tenon cutter 3 is completed.
